Abstract

The invention discloses a pixel circuit, a driving method and a display, comprising: a compensation unit connected to a driving unit; an external power supply, a driving unit and a first light-emitting unit sequentially connected in series; a capacitor located between the first node and an external power supply; an initialization unit The first electrode of the first initialization transistor is connected to the first node, the gate of the first initialization transistor is externally connected to the second scanning signal, the second electrode of the first initialization transistor is connected to the second light emitting unit, and the first electrode of the second initialization transistor The electrodes are connected to the second light-emitting unit, the second electrode of the second initialization transistor is externally connected to the initialization voltage, and the gate of the second initialization transistor is externally connected to the second scanning signal; the first initialization transistor and the second initialization transistor are a double-gate transistor. The invention can actually avoid the influence of the external power supply on the data signal, improve the luminescence stability of the light emitting diode and simplify the circuit.

Description

technical field [0001] The invention relates to the technical field of electronic displays, in particular to a pixel circuit, a driving method and a display. Background technique [0002] In an existing pixel circuit, generally a light emitting diode in the pixel circuit is driven to emit light through a thin film transistor, and this thin film transistor is called a driving transistor. The driving transistor works in a saturated state, because in the saturated state, the sensitivity of the driving current output by the driving transistor to the source-drain voltage is lower than that of the driving transistor in the linear state, which can provide a more stable driving current for the light emitting diode. figure 1 For the existing most basic pixel circuit, such as figure 1 As shown, the pixel circuit is composed of two transistors T11 and T12, and a capacitor C11.
